Technical field
The utility model relates to galvanizing technique field, specially a kind of zinc-plated station-service is in the zinc-plated hoist cable of lifting.
Background technique
The zinc-plated table referred to the effects of the surface of metal, alloy or other materials one layer of zinc of plating is to play beauty, antirust Surface treatment technology, the method mainly used are hot galvanizings.
When carrying out zinc-plated processing to metal, need to lift object using to hoist cable, existing hoist cable is using When, due to the phenomenon that long-time uses, and hoist cable will appear damage, lead to the existing zinc-plated hoist cable of lifting service life when in use It is short, so that the practicability of hoist cable is influenced, for this purpose, it is proposed that a kind of zinc-plated station-service is in the zinc-plated hoist cable of lifting.

(2) technical solution
To realize above-mentioned purpose with long service life, the utility model is provided the following technical solutions: a kind of zinc-plated station-service in Zinc-plated hoist cable, including lantern ring are lifted, connecting rod is fixedly connected on the right side of the lantern ring, is fixedly connected on the right side of the connecting rod There is fixed link, support rod is fixedly connected on the right side of the fixed link, fixed ring, institute are connected on the right side of the support rod It states and is fixedly connected with suspension hook on the right side of fixed ring, wearing layer is provided on the inside of the suspension hook, is provided on the outside of the suspension hook Erosion resistant coating, the wearing layer include polyurethane coating layer, polyester imine resin layer and layer of polyurethane, the erosion resistant coating packet Include epoxy resin layer, furane resins layer and zinc silicate coating layer.
Preferably, the polyurethane coating layer is located at the top of polyester imine resin layer, polyester imine resin layer position In the top of layer of polyurethane.
Preferably, the epoxy resin layer is located at the top of furane resins layer, and the furane resins layer is located at zinc silicate painting The top of the bed of material.
Preferably, the polyurethane coating layer with a thickness of 30 microns to 40 microns, the thickness of the polyester imine resin layer Degree be 40 microns to 50 microns, the layer of polyurethane with a thickness of 50 microns to 60 microns.
Preferably, the epoxy resin layer with a thickness of 10 microns to 20 microns, the furane resins layer with a thickness of 20 Micron to 30 microns, the zinc silicate coating layer with a thickness of 30 microns to 40 microns.
